Hello, I'm using a SuSE SLES Server, with OpenLDAP 2.2.6, used for user authentication. Since I changed the IP configuration and the root Password the OpenLDAP-Server doesn't save the information! I can create a new user, use it, change it, but after a reboot the user disappers. Which configuration I have to check? I really need any tips, i don't now what I can do, where I have to search the problem.
You may not be checkpointing your database. Look at the slapd.conf checkpoint directive.
BTW, 2.2.6 is extremely old and has many many known bugs. 2.2.27 is the current release, and 2.2.26 is the current stable release.
